在項目中高效使用php fputs,可以遵循以下幾個建議:
使用文件指針:在使用 fputs 函數之前,先使用 fopen 函數打開文件,并將返回的文件指針保存起來。這樣可以避免在每次寫入數據時都要重新打開文件。
批量寫入數據:如果需要寫入大量數據,建議將數據批量處理后再進行寫入,而不是分開多次調用 fputs 函數。
使用緩沖區:可以使用 PHP 的緩沖區功能來提高寫入效率。可以使用 ob_start 函數開啟緩沖區,然后使用 ob_get_flush 函數將緩沖區的內容寫入文件。
鎖定文件:如果多個進程同時寫入同一個文件,可以使用 flock 函數對文件進行鎖定,避免數據混亂。
錯誤處理:在寫入文件時,要及時捕獲可能出現的錯誤并進行相應的處理,以確保數據寫入的穩定性。
通過以上建議,可以在項目中高效使用 php fputs 函數進行文件寫入操作。